Sihai village hails Court order, retains title suit
Source: The Sangai Express / Mungchan Zimik
Ukhrul, September 08 2019:
Dismissing a plaintiff petition filed by the village head of Lunghar village and party regarding the case related to rightful possession of a land suit (Sihai Phangrei /Schedule B land), Civil Judge (Sr Division), Imphal East delivered judgement in favour of defendants K Luingam and party of Sihai village, Ukhrul.
In a press conference held today at Ukhrul District Working Journalists Association (UDWJA) office, Viewland Ukhrul, the villagers of Sihai village shared their satisfaction with the Court order which was delivered after nine years trial at the Civil Court, Imphal and dismissed the the plaintiff petition after minute investigation about the facts by the learned Judge.

According to K Luingam, Lunghar Village Headman L Wungnaoshang and party moved and filed a plaintiff petition at Civil Judge (Sr Division) Imphal East in 2009 against the order of Tangkhul Naga Long Court which is a Tangkhul Customary Court that delivered a judgement in favour of Sihai village to enjoy the possession of the land suit /Sihai Phangrei /Schedule B land after both the Sihai village and the Lunghar village were put to a challenge as per the Tangkhul Customary Law Court for rightful claim of the disputed land.
"The challenge was to remain immersed in the water for longer period of time by the villager of the two villages and the one who stayed longer inside the water will be declared winner of the challenge to enjoy the rightful possession of the suit land (Sihai Phangrei/ Schedule B land)", he maintained.
He further said that after both the parties mutually agreed to the challenge, it was executed at Nungshang Kong (river) in the presence of Tangkhul Customary Judges, representatives of both villages and observers in October 2008.After that, a Judgement was delivered in favour of Sihai village by the Tangkhul Naga Long Court, he asserted.
